Welder-Skilled Trade

Welder-Skilled Trade
June 1, 2022 by LorriK

Did you know that Welding is a Red Seal Skilled Trade?

To become a Welder you must complete a 3 year apprenticeship. This apprenticeship involves 5,280 hours of on-the-job work experience and 720 hours of in-school training permanently.

Some of the things you might do as a Welder include:

  • shielded metal arc welding
  • gas metal arc welding
  • gas tungsten arc welding
  • plasma arc welding
  • submerged arc welding
  • automatic/semi-automatic processes
  • fitting/fabrication
  • brazing
  • thermal cutting: oxy-fuel-gas, plasma arc, air carbon arc
